Liquefied natural gas (LNG) storage tanks are specialized products for storing LNG. They are special equipment, Class III pressure vessels, and undergo rigorous manufacturing processes including flaw detection, hydrostatic and pneumatic pressure testing, on-site inspection by the technical supervision bureau, and issuance of a pressure vessel inspection certificate. External rust removal and painting are also part of the manufacturing process. LNG storage tanks undergo strict quality assessments regarding the materials, dimensions, weld quality, operational quality, installation quality, internal devices, and safety accessories of pressure-bearing components. Routine physical and chemical tests are conducted on the tank materials, such as mechanical properties and chemical composition. Welded joints, welds, tank heads, and the geometric positions of various pressure-bearing components are rigorously inspected using X-ray non-destructive testing and magnetic particle testing. The product's sealing performance, pressure resistance, and all technical indicators that could affect its safe operation are also tested.

Processing capabilities and technological advantages:
1. Laser cutting ensures high precision with an error within 0.05 mm, guaranteeing welding quality; heat exchanger baffles can be directly laser-cut.
2. For stainless steel longitudinal and circumferential welds ≤10 mm thick, plasma welding is used, with single-sided welding and double-sided forming, reducing welding wire consumption. Compared to submerged arc welding, it eliminates the need for carbon arc gouging, avoiding carburization, resulting in a beautiful appearance, low heat input, and excellent weld quality. Radiographic testing pass rate is over 99%.
3. Argon arc automatic welding machine provides high and stable welding quality and a beautiful weld appearance.
Advantages of a professional, assembly-line production model:
Product manufacturing is divided into more than a dozen processes, including material cutting, head pressing, rolling, longitudinal and circumferential welding, assembly welding, machining, heat treatment, hydrostatic testing, sandblasting, and painting. Each process is equipped with professional personnel, and there is a secondary division of labor within each process, which effectively improves work efficiency and product quality.
